上海交通大学
硕士学位论文
基于数字图像处理的伺服系统控制
姓名:陈肇翔
申请学位级别:硕士
专业:电子信息与电气工程
指导教师:陈坚
20090201
上海交通大学工程硕士学位论文摘要
基于图像处理的伺服系统控制
摘要
本文针对伺服系统,在研究数字图像处理的基础上,建立了一个基
,伺服控
制系统模块和 OPC 通信模块三部分。提出了基于 USB 摄像头的图像处理
的方法和流程,为实现系统良好的通信,采用了广泛使用的 OPC 技术。
图像是通过 USB 摄像头获得的,基于 Windows 平台和 OpenCV 实现。
软件中为使得识别有较好的效果,在识别算法之前,首先对摄像头进行
了定标以补偿误差,同时还对图像进行了滤波处理以获取更加平滑的图
片,消除噪音对识别效果的干扰。识别的目标主要有两个,其一是平台
上的迷宫,它的识别以找出的特定像素点的特性为基础进行;另外一个
是平台上的物体,即小球,这里对小球的识别有两种方法:基于 Hough
变化的方法和采用的迭代求解的方法。由于在获取小球的运动信息时候
期望能够以尽快地速度进行,所以在实现时候采用了后者。经图像识别,
得到迷宫的模型和小球的位置之后,为达到具体的终点,本文采用了
Dijkstra 算法,其实现上根据迷宫无向图的具体特点,采用了基于横纵
两个矩阵的处理方法。
伺服控制系统是硬件上采用 Cotrollogix5550 PLC、1756-M08SE 多
轴伺服控制器、Ultra3000-SE 伺服驱动器、Y-1002-2-H 型伺服电机构
建成一个二自由度的运动控制平台;软件采用 Rslinx 和 Rslogix5000。
PLC 作为硬件系统的唯一控制器,可以通过一定的控制算法控制伺服电机
第 I 页
上海交通大学工程硕士学位论文摘要
动作,伺服电机带动运动平台按照不同的方向和角度进行倾斜,进而控
制小球在此平台上的运动。OPC 通讯模块用于实现图像处理模块与 PLC 控
制程序的数据交互,来实现对小球运动轨迹的实时跟踪。OPC 服务器采用
Rslinx,OPC 客户端是基于 WINTECH 公司的 上开发。之所
以采用 OPC 方式主要理由在于其扩展性、通用性很强,另外在现有的 OPC
服务器上开发 OPC 客户端的方式广泛应用于工业界。
关键词:图像处理伺服控制 ControlLogix OpenCV
第 II 页
上海交通大学工程硕士学位论文 ABSTRACT
The Servo Control System Based on Digital Image Processing
Abstract
In this paper, after studying digital image processing theory,
constructed a feedback control system based on digital image
system is consist of three parts: the Digital Image
Processing model, Servo Control System and munication.
Developed an image processing flow based on USB order
to acquire munication, OPC technique which broadly adopt
in the industrial area is used.
The image is captured by USB camara, and its processing is
realized on Windows platform and the open source lib
order to make the recognition algorithm to work well, camara
calibration which used pensate the distortion and filter is
performed in order to give a better image for
[毕业论文]基于数字图像处理的伺服系统控制 来自淘豆网www.taodocs.com转载请标明出处.